Puffins at Clystheath provides a safe and engaging environment for children to enjoy their day at nursery and learn about the world around them. The nursery is a converted Victorian chapel and has been open since 1995.

Staff are qualified to provide a high level of care and boost children's learning and social skills through play.

The secure nursery also has a garden area which children are encouraged to play in all year round. As well as the garden area children are taken on regular trips to local parks and green areas which are enjoyable for children and adults alike.

My son has been very happy at the nursery for nearly 3 years. The staff at all levels have always welcomed him and taken the trouble to relate to him on an individual level. The open plan nature of the nursery space means that children are well known to, and well aware of, the staff in other age groups.
This helps with settling in as they move up in age groups.


Although I have always been happy with the provision of care, recent changes have seen a significant improvement in the organisation of the nursery and information provided to parents.


The nursery setting may not suit a very quiet, reserved child because of the open plan space but my outgoing child has always found the level of interaction between the other children and members of staff to be very enjoyable.

Detailed Breakdown of Review Score

The maximum Review Score for a Day Nursery is 10, which is made up from the Average Rating of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) and the Number of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) in the last 24 months:

  1. 5 Points are available for the Average Rating from all Reviews in the last 24 months. The Average Rating of 4.964 for Puffins at Clystheath is calculated as follows: ( (161 Excellents x 5) + (6 Goods x 4) ) ÷ 167 Ratings = 4.964
  2. 5 Points are available for the number of Positive Reviews in the last 24 months. A Positive Review is defined as any Review with an 'Overall Experience' of '4' or '5' (out of a max rating '5'). The 5 Points relating to the number of positive Reviews for Puffins at Clystheath is based on 14 positive Reviews in the last 24 months and is calculated as per below:

    The 5 points available are broken down as follows:

    1. 4 points are available for the first 10 Positive Reviews in the last 24 months; 3 points for the first Positive Review, and then 0.125 Points for each of the next four Positive Reviews and then 0.1 Points for the next five Positive Reviews. (1st = 3.000, 2nd = 0.125, 3rd = 0.125, 4th = 0.125, 5th = 0.125, 6th = 0.100, 7th = 0.100, 8th = 0.100, 9th = 0.100, 10th = 0.100) 3 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 = 4
    2. 1 point is available for the number of Positive Reviews reaching 20% of the number of registered child places in the last 24 months. If this number is partially reached, then that proportion of 1 point is given. eg a Day Nursery registered for a maximum of 50 child places has to reach 10 Positive Reviews to receive 1 point, if it has 7 reviews it will receive 0.7 points. 20% of the 60 number of registered child places is 12, which has been reached with 14 Positive reviews. Points = 1
  3. When a Review is submitted by someone who has previously submitted a Review, only the latest Review will count towards the Review Score.
  4. If a Day Nursery does not have a review in the last 24 months, then it will not have a Review Score.

Puffins at Clystheath have an established team, led by Chantelle who has worked for Puffins since 2016.


Chantelle is Level 3 qualified in Childcare with a Level 5 Lead Practitioner qualification and is supported by her Deputy Kira.


The nursery is spread over 1 floor with individual spaces for each age group. Children can explore a variety of different rooms, supported by caring and diligent staff who work hard to ensure every child is loved and cared for as an individual.
